This is Malaysia - Truly Asia




I have taken you around my school (ISKL) campus in my previous blog. I am sure you would like to know more about Malaysia. Malaysia is a country adjoining Thailand & Singapore in the South-East Asia. It is multicultural and people of all nationalities live here. Malaysia is very close to the equator (naturally we have warm weather throughout the year!!). I came to Malaysia just 7 months ago. I am fascinated by the beauty of the country ever since I have been here. It is beautiful with wonderful people, hills and beaches, rainforests, huge shopping malls and tasty food as well. The world famous PETRONAS TWIN TOWERS are here and so is the world’s biggest flower -Rafflesia Arnoldii, which is found near the Cameron Highlands. The beaches in Malaysia are awesome and I love to go for Jet Ski, Para sailing and other beach activities.
